What is a KML File?

KML files, at their core, are XML-based files used to store geographic data and associated content. Think of them as containers for all sorts of location-based information. This can include everything from placemarks, which are like digital pins on a map marking specific locations, to more complex elements such as paths, polygons, and even images and 3D models. The beauty of KML lies in its ability to represent geographical features with rich detail and context, making it a favorite among map enthusiasts, GIS professionals, and anyone who needs to visualize spatial data.

To truly grasp the power of KML, it's essential to understand its structure and the types of information it can hold. Within a KML file, you'll typically find elements that define the geographical coordinates (latitude and longitude), descriptions, names, and visual styles of map features. This means you can not only mark a location but also add a description, customize its appearance with different icons and colors, and even link to external resources like images or websites. For example, you could create a KML file to map out your favorite hiking trails, marking points of interest along the way with descriptions and photos. Or, a city planner might use KML to visualize zoning regulations, outlining different zones as colored polygons on a map. The possibilities are vast, and the level of detail you can include makes KML a powerful tool for storytelling and data presentation on a map.

Furthermore, KML's open standard format ensures its compatibility across various platforms and applications, making it a versatile choice for sharing geographical data. Whether you're using Google Earth, Google Maps, or other GIS software, KML files can be easily imported and displayed, allowing for seamless collaboration and data exchange. This interoperability is a key advantage, as it enables users to work with KML files in their preferred environment without worrying about format conversions or compatibility issues. How to Create a KML File

Creating a KML file might sound intimidating at first, but it's actually quite straightforward. There are several methods you can use, depending on your needs and technical expertise. One of the simplest ways is to use Google Earth, which provides a user-friendly interface for creating and editing KML files. Within Google Earth, you can add placemarks, draw lines and polygons, and customize the appearance of your map features with various icons, colors, and styles. This visual approach makes it easy to build complex KML files without having to write any code. For instance, you could use Google Earth to map out a scenic driving route, marking points of interest along the way with descriptive placemarks and photos. Or, you could create a polygon to represent a park or protected area, adding a description of its ecological significance.

For those who prefer a more hands-on approach, you can also create KML files using a text editor. KML is based on XML, a markup language that uses tags to define elements and attributes. This means you can write KML code directly, giving you fine-grained control over every aspect of your file. While this method requires a basic understanding of XML syntax, it allows for greater flexibility and customization. There are numerous online resources and tutorials available to help you learn the KML language, and many text editors offer features like syntax highlighting and code completion to make the process easier. For example, you could write KML code to create a detailed map of a city, including buildings, roads, and points of interest, each with custom styles and descriptions. Or, you could generate KML files programmatically using scripting languages like Python, which can be useful for automating the creation of maps from large datasets.

Another option is to use specialized GIS software, such as QGIS or ArcGIS, which offer advanced tools for creating and editing KML files. These programs provide a wealth of features for working with spatial data, including geoprocessing tools, coordinate system transformations, and advanced styling options. GIS software is particularly useful for creating KML files from existing geospatial data, such as shapefiles or geodatabases. For instance, you could use QGIS to convert a shapefile of property boundaries into a KML file, which could then be used to display property information on Google Maps. Or, you could use ArcGIS to create a KML file showing the results of a spatial analysis, such as a heat map of crime rates or a buffer zone around a protected area. How to Open a KML File in Google Maps

Opening a KML file in Google Maps is a simple process, but the method varies slightly depending on whether you're using the web version of Google Maps or the mobile app. On the web version, the easiest way to open a KML file is to use Google My Maps. Google My Maps is a web-based tool that allows you to create and customize your own maps using Google Maps as a base. To import a KML file, simply open Google My Maps, create a new map, and then select the "Import" option. You can then browse your computer for the KML file you want to open and upload it to your map. Google Maps will automatically parse the KML file and display the geographical features it contains, such as placemarks, lines, and polygons. This is a great way to visualize your data and share it with others. For example, you could import a KML file containing hiking trails and points of interest in a national park, allowing you to create a custom map for your next outdoor adventure.

In the Google Maps mobile app, the process is a bit different. As of the latest updates, the Google Maps app doesn't directly support importing KML files. However, there's a workaround: you can still view KML files on your mobile device by first uploading them to Google My Maps using the web interface, as described above. Once the KML file is imported into Google My Maps, you can then open the map in the Google Maps app on your mobile device. Your custom data will be displayed as a layer on top of the standard Google Maps interface, allowing you to view your KML file on the go. This method ensures that you have access to your custom maps and data even when you're away from your computer. For instance, a real estate agent could import a KML file of property listings into Google My Maps and then view the map on their phone while visiting potential clients.

It's important to note that Google My Maps has some limitations in terms of the size and complexity of KML files it can handle. Very large or complex KML files may take a long time to load or may not display correctly. If you're working with very large datasets, you may need to simplify your KML file or consider using a different tool, such as Google Earth, which is designed to handle larger and more complex geographical data. Additionally, Google My Maps allows you to collaborate with others on your custom maps, making it a great tool for group projects or for sharing information with a team. You can invite others to view or edit your map, making it easy to work together on mapping projects.

Tips for Working with KML Files

Working with KML files can be incredibly rewarding, but there are a few tips and tricks that can help you streamline your workflow and ensure the best results. One of the most important tips is to keep your KML files organized. As you start working with more and more KML files, it's easy for them to become cluttered and difficult to manage. To avoid this, establish a clear naming convention for your files and organize them into folders based on project, date, or category. This will make it much easier to find the files you need when you need them. For example, you might create a folder for each city you've mapped, with subfolders for different types of data, such as points of interest, transportation routes, and zoning districts.

Another key tip is to validate your KML files before using them. KML files are based on XML, which has a strict syntax. Even a small error, such as a missing tag or an incorrect attribute, can prevent your KML file from displaying correctly in Google Maps or other applications. Fortunately, there are many online KML validators that can help you check your files for errors. Simply upload your KML file to the validator, and it will scan the file and report any issues it finds. This can save you a lot of time and frustration by catching errors early on. For instance, you might use a KML validator to check a file you've created by hand in a text editor, ensuring that all the tags are correctly nested and that all the required attributes are present.

When creating KML files, it's also important to be mindful of file size. Large KML files can take a long time to load and may even cause performance issues in Google Maps or other applications. To minimize file size, try to simplify your data as much as possible. For example, if you're mapping a large number of points, consider using fewer decimal places for the coordinates. You can also use styling to reduce the amount of data that needs to be displayed. For instance, instead of using a detailed polygon to represent a park, you might use a simpler shape or a point with a custom icon. Additionally, consider using network links to break your KML data into smaller, more manageable chunks. Network links allow you to load KML data dynamically, only displaying the data that's currently visible in the map view. This can significantly improve performance, especially when working with very large datasets. Common Issues and Troubleshooting

Like any technology, working with KML files and Google Maps can sometimes present challenges. It’s essential to be aware of common issues and how to troubleshoot them to ensure a smooth experience. One frequent problem is KML files not displaying correctly in Google Maps. This can manifest in various ways, such as missing features, incorrect styling, or the entire file failing to load. When this happens, the first step is to check the KML file for errors. As mentioned earlier, KML files are based on XML and must adhere to a specific syntax. Even a small mistake, like an unclosed tag or a misspelled attribute, can prevent the file from being parsed correctly. Use a KML validator to identify any syntax errors in your file and correct them.

Another common issue is large KML files causing performance problems. If your KML file contains a lot of data, such as thousands of placemarks or complex polygons, it can take a long time to load and may even cause Google Maps to become unresponsive. To address this, try simplifying your KML file. One approach is to reduce the number of features in your file. For example, if you're mapping a large area, you might consider displaying only the most important features or aggregating data into clusters. Another strategy is to simplify the geometry of your features. For instance, you could replace detailed polygons with simpler shapes or use fewer vertices to represent lines and polygons. Additionally, using network links to load data dynamically can significantly improve performance by only loading the data that's currently visible in the map view.

Sometimes, issues can arise from compatibility problems. Google Maps supports most KML features, but there are some limitations. Certain advanced KML features, such as 3D models or time-based animations, may not display correctly in Google Maps. If you're using advanced KML features, it's a good idea to test your file in Google Maps to ensure that everything is displayed as expected. If you encounter compatibility issues, you may need to adjust your KML file or consider using a different tool, such as Google Earth, which supports a wider range of KML features. Furthermore, issues can sometimes be caused by browser or app problems. If you're experiencing problems loading KML files in Google Maps, try clearing your browser cache and cookies or updating the Google Maps app to the latest version. In rare cases, there may be a bug in Google Maps itself. If you suspect this is the case, you can report the issue to Google through their support channels.
